For Academic Year 2013-2014
Students are no longer required to file the Free Application for Federal Student Aid (FAFSA) before Florida Bright Futures Scholarship funds can disburse. This requirement was repealed by 2013 legislation.

At UNF, Bright Futures is initially awarded to students with a "placeholder" amount. This placeholder is based on an average of 15 credit hours at the prior year's rate per credit hour. Once registration has begun for the upcoming academic term, students will notice that their Bright Futures awards have adjusted. This adjustment is based on their actual number of hours enrolled and the current year's award rate (as established by the Florida State Legislature).
Renewal Eligibility
Renewal eligibility is an automatic process that occurs at the end of the spring term for those students who received funding during the current year. UNF reports the overall cumulative GPA and hours completed for the year to the Office of Student Financial Assistance (OSFA) of the Florida Department of Education in Tallahassee. Renewal students must earn the GPA and the required hours indicated below on all college coursework attempted, including high school dual coursework. The student may request the exclusion of dual enrollment courses completed while attending high school from the GPA, if needed to meet requirements by submitting a Bright Futures Action Request Form.

Withdrawn Classes
A student must repay the state any scholarship funds received for a course dropped or withdrawn after the initial add/drop period. A debt will be placed on the student account, which must be paid to UNF. UNF will then reimburse the state. Failure to pay back a debt owed due to withdrawn hours will render a student ineligible to receive funding in subsequent years.
Failure to meet renewal requirements
Renewal criteria must be met each academic year. Failure to meet renewal criteria will result in loss of scholarship. If a student fails to meet renewal criteria when grades and hours are reported to the State at the end of the Spring term, a student may be able to attend summer semester in order to attempt a restoration of their scholarship for the next academic year. However, eligibility for restoration differs from student to student based on high school graduation year.
